Inside a Forged Wheels Factory: Process and Innovation

State-of-the-art forged wheels site is a intriguing blend of major machinery and thorough engineering.The initial step involves receiving bars of top-quality aluminum mixture. Later heated to intense temperatures, typically between 1,050 and 1,200 degrees Celsius, to render them flexible enough for the forging method. Subsequently, a powered press, capable of creating immense force—often exceeding 600 tons—models the worked aluminum into the primary wheel contour. This forging step significantly reduces porosity and improves the material's toughness. Following forging, the wheel undergoes a sequence of additional operations. These comprise automated machining to secure precise dimensions and detailed profiles.

  • Outer finishing, such as grinding,improves the wheel's aesthetic.
  • Rigorous control measures are implemented throughout the entire process, utilizing up-to-date scrutiny equipment.
  • Modern technologies, like current oversight systems and machine-learning enhancement algorithms, are now included to maximize efficiency and restrict waste.
The obligation to evolution ensures that each forged wheel complies with the top standards of safety and design.

Sable Constructed Circles vs. Colored: Which is Best for Your Truck?

When weighing recent alloys for your car, patrons often notice the selection between dark forged circles and layered ones. Crafted wheels are typically resilient and less bulky due to their building process, generating increased performance. However, they demand a raised cost. Covered rims, on the opposite side, are usually inexpensive but can be less resistant to scuffs and involve constant servicing. Ultimately, the best preference relies on your funds and demands regarding handling.

Slim Forged Rotors Reduce Weight,Augment Handling

Adopting lightweight fabricated wheels offers a significant gain for any automobile. By decreasing removed heft, these circles dramatically enhance maneuvering and acceleration. This is because diminished energy is needed to pivot the treads, leading to greater cornering and slowing. Ultimately,trim alloys translate to a advanced driving sensation and a evidently faster cycle.
